Milan is aiming for Castellanos as deputy Ramos
The Devil evaluates the Argentinian from West Ham as an alternative to Giménez to support the new Portuguese striker.

AC Milan are seriously considering the purchase of Valentín 'Taty' Castellanos to fill the role of assistant to Gonçalo Ramos, should Santiago Giménez leave the club during this transfer window. The Rossoneri management is working to complete the advanced department with a reliable profile already tested in competitive championships, focusing on the Argentine fresh from experience in the Premier League. Castellanos played for West Ham in the second part of the season, scoring 6 goals in 18 appearances, numbers that demonstrate a good ability to make an impact despite the difficulty of the English champion.
